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Скачиваний:
62
Добавлен:
17.04.2013
Размер:
782.85 Кб
Скачать

Адресация и маршрутизация

Для отсутствия противоречий в процессе обмена сообщениями каждый поль­зователь почтовой системы должен иметь в ней уникальный почтовый адрес. Этот адрес должен идентифицировать именно пользователя, а не используе­мый этим пользователем компьютер. Схему назначения уникальных адресов пользователям в той или иной почтовой системе называют адресацией.

При наличии в сети избыточных связей доставка сообщения получателю должна осуществляться по оптимальному маршруту от почтового сервера от­правителя к почтовому серверу получателя. Процесс выбора очередного пунк­та на пути следования сообщения к почтовому серверу-получателю, называе­мый маршрутизацией, осуществляется на основе специальных таблиц. Маршрутизация почтовых сообщений реализуется поверх маршрутизации па­кетов сетевого уровня. После выбора очередного транзитного почтового сер­вера в соответствии с правилами маршрутизации почтовых сообщений осуще­ствляется маршрутизация на сетевом уровне модели OSI для оптимальной доставки выбранному транзитному серверу.

Схемы адресации и маршрутизации в конкретной системе электронной почты определяются применяемым протоколом обмена почтовыми сообщениями. Администратору, в чьи задачи входит обеспечение взаимодействия между не­сколькими разнородными системами передачи сообщений, необходимо знать методы адресации и маршрутизации, используемые в каждой из них. Рас­смотрим схемы адресации и маршрутизации на примере протокола SMTP.

Адресация в smtp

В системах на базе SMTP используется интуитивно понятная, простая и од­новременно очень мощная иерархическая схема адресации, аналогичная той, что принята в службе имен Internet (Domain Name Services или DNS).

Данная схема может обеспечить уникальность адреса практически неогра­ниченному числу пользователей. Почтовый адрес SMTP записывается в сле­дующем виде:

mailbox@domain

где mailbox — символическое имя почтового ящика пользователя (длиной до 63 символов), a domain — уникальное имя почтового домена, в котором зарегистрирован упомянутый пользователь (длиной до 255 символов). Соче­тание имен почтового ящика и почтового домена образует уникальный идентификатор пользователя.

Почтовый домен хранит полную информацию о положении системы в иерархии почтового пространства организации (рис.4.). В имени домена имя каждого следующего уровня иерархии отделяется от предыдущего точ­кой. Разбор имени домена выполняется справа налево. Самый верхний уро­вень, называемый корневым доменом, соответствует либо типу организации (например, com — коммерческая, gov — государственная, org — общест­венная), либо географическому региону (например, ги — Россия, a fr — Франция). Следующими в иерархии идут домены первого уровня, как пра­вило, представляющие имя организации.

рис.4 Иерарх.схема адресации

Регистрацией имен доменов первого уровня занимается международный центр Internet (Internet Network Information Center или InterNIC). За назна­чение имен доменов более низкого уровня чаще всего отвечают сами ком­пании. Поскольку организациям не запрещается регистрировать для собст­венных нужд несколько параллельных доменов (например, spektr.spb.ru и spektr.com), пользователь может иметь более одного SMTP-адреса. Кро­ме того, современные SMTP-системы зачастую позволяют назначать псев­донимы для самого почтового ящика.

В приведенном примере spektr.spb.ru является субдоменом spb.ru, ко­торый в свою очередь является субдоменом ru. Компания SPEKTR имеет два зарегистрированных имени, и каждый пользователь может иметь два почтовых адреса.

Соседние файлы в папке Другие сети от другого Малова